In healthcare SEO, Google enforces a distinct, algorithmic zero-tolerance policy. If your medical content fails to meet the highest thresholds of Expertise, Experience, Authoritativeness, and Trustworthiness (E-E-A-T), it will be suppressed.

This strict paradigm is known as YMYL (Your Money or Your Life). Search engines understand that inaccurate medical information can physically harm users. Therefore, traditional SEO tactics like keyword density or basic backlinking are entirely insufficient. You must construct an architecture built exclusively on verifiable trust.

1. Deep Technical Analysis: Proving Expertise Programmatically

You cannot just "tell" Google your content is accurate; you must provide programmatic evidence.

Medical Authorship & Review Validation: An anonymous "Editorial Team" byline is unacceptable in YMYL. Every clinical page must explicitly attribute authorship to a credentialed professional (MD, DO, RN) using a dedicated, crawlable Author Bio page.

Furthermore, you must implement a strict "Medical Review Board" workflow. Every article must prominently display a "Medically Reviewed By [Name + Credentials]" badge, paired with a timestamp.

Advanced Medical Schema (JSON-LD): To inject your authority directly into Google's Knowledge Graph, you must utilize highly specific schema markup that goes far beyond standard Article schema:

  • MedicalWebPage: Specifically defines the content as healthcare-related.
  • MedicalCondition: Connects symptoms, causes, and treatments to known medical databases.
  • Physician: Programmatically links the author's credentials, NPI number, and educational background to the document.

3. Hard Metrics: The Baseline YMYL Requirements

If your healthcare site fails these baseline metrics, you run the immediate risk of a core algorithm update penalty:

  • Author Transparency: 100% of clinical pages must feature a clearly stated, credentialed author or medical reviewer.
  • Citation Integrity: 100% of specific medical claims (statistics, dosages, treatments) must include explicit outbound citations to primary, high-authority sources (DA 70+ domains like .gov, .edu, PubMed, or the CDC).
  • Content Freshness: The "Last Medically Reviewed" timestamp must strictly be within the last 12 months for all evergreen clinical pages to prove clinical guideline adherence.
  • Core Web Vitals: A slow site implies a neglected, untrustworthy site. LCP must be strictly < 2.5s, and INP < 200ms.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is YMYL in healthcare SEO?

YMYL stands for "Your Money or Your Life." It is a strict classification by Google for content that can significantly impact a user's health, safety, financial stability, or well-being. Healthcare pages are held to the highest possible algorithmic quality thresholds.

How do you prove E-E-A-T in medical content?

You must provide verifiable signals of trust: utilizing credentialed authors (MDs, RNs), establishing a formal medical review board, providing transparent citations to peer-reviewed journals, maintaining detailed author bio pages with NPI numbers, and ensuring secure HTTPS site architecture.

Does schema markup help with healthcare SEO?

Yes, significantly. Standard schema is not enough. You must implement specific JSON-LD structures like MedicalEntity, MedicalWebPage, and Physician to programmatically communicate your clinical expertise directly to Google's Knowledge Graph.

How often should medical content be updated?

YMYL content must be reviewed and updated at least annually, or immediately upon the release of new clinical guidelines or FDA warnings. Your pages must include highly visible "Last Updated" and "Medically Reviewed By" timestamps.
